Key differences

When to pick Sitiva Blend

  • More myrcene - pronounced citrus and resinous notes

When to pick Enigma

  • Higher alpha acid - stronger bittering
  • Higher beta acid - smoother, longer-lasting bitterness
  • Richer, more complex aroma profile

Property

PropertySitiva BlendEnigma
Alpha acid7.2–7.6%13.5–19.4%
Beta acid4.2–4.5%4.5–7.1%
Co-humulone27–28%37–43%
Total oil-1.8–3 mL
Myrcene50–58%23–30%
Humulene10–11%12–19%
Caryophyllene-6–8%
Farnesene9–10%9–12%
OriginUnited StatesAustralia
PurposeAromaAroma
